Fallback on posix_fallocate if fallocate fail
Not every FS support the fallocate system call. Falling back to posix_fallocate would allow more compatibility at the expense of some performance penalty. But I think it's worth it. Maybe with a one-time warning?
Which OS do you have in mind? On GNU/Linux, posix_fallocate is implemented using fallocate (see posix_fallocate.c), so that wouldn't increase compatiblity.
In the glibc posix_fallocate is implemented using the fallocate syscall first. But falls back onto an emulated implentation if the syscall fail with EOPNOTSUPP. This implementation should work on almost every file system.
